Betting, often called gambling, is probably the oldest and most common sorts of human recreation. Its origins trace back again to ancient civilizations, the place people placed wagers on almost everything from sporting contests to animal fights and perhaps video games of possibility involving rudimentary dice or cards. After some time, betting has remodeled from a straightforward social action right into a multi-billion-greenback world wide marketplace that spans casinos, racetracks, sports activities arenas, and digital platforms. Although it proceeds to captivate hundreds of thousands While using the thrill of uncertainty as well as hope of reward, betting also delivers with it elaborate social, psychological, and economic implications that are worthy of watchful consideration.

Betting is a Portion of human society for millennia. The main regarded data of gambling day back again to historical China, in which rudimentary video games of possibility have been utilized to finance point out projects. In Historical Egypt and Greece, betting was also common—frequently tied to religious rituals or competitive occasions like chariot races and gladiator online games. The Roman Empire observed a boom in gambling pursuits, In spite of legal makes an attempt to ban them. Citizens regularly wagered on dice games and sporting occasions. Over time, betting moved into Europe through the Middle Ages, exactly where it turned connected to cards and horse racing, eventually evolving into structured forms controlled by royal decrees and law. The modern period brought about casinos, lotteries, and at some point electronic betting platforms—radically growing accessibility and developing new types of bettors.

The most compelling components of betting is its psychological appeal. Betting activates the Mind’s reward program, releasing dopamine—a neurotransmitter associated with satisfaction and pleasure—when a person places a wager or wins. This dopamine hurry usually gets to be addictive, as players start to associate betting with instant gratification and psychological highs. Quite a few gamblers are also drawn with the illusion of Regulate or belief in styles, even in games of pure prospect. Concepts for example “novice’s luck” or “remaining due for your earn” illustrate the cognitive biases that push folks to carry on betting, at times even towards their improved judgment. Risk-having is yet another innate human conduct that betting taps into. The adrenaline hurry that emanates from jeopardizing revenue on an uncertain result could be thrilling and also euphoric, earning the exercise really engaging and sometimes difficult to walk far from.

The whole world of betting is vast and assorted, providing options for nearly just about every curiosity and inclination. Amongst the preferred varieties of betting are sports activities betting, the place wagers are put on the end result of sporting activities occasions like football, cricket, and horse racing. On line casino betting involves games of opportunity like blackjack, poker, roulette, and slot devices. The increase of the web has resulted in a surge in on-line betting platforms, like mobile applications and websites that provide Stay and virtual betting encounters. Lotteries and scratch cards, frequently federal government-regulated, bring in hundreds of thousands While using the hope of profitable massive, random prizes. A more moderen, quickly-escalating segment is eSports and Digital athletics betting, where bets are put on video clip game competitions or simulated sports outcomes. There exists also financial betting, which requires speculating on sector movements, which include predicting whether or not inventory selling prices will rise or fall inside a particular timeframe.

Betting is a large world-wide business, contributing billions to countrywide economies. It results in employment options in casinos, sports venues, and tech organizations that build betting platforms. Government-sanctioned betting, like lotteries or accredited sportsbooks, often generates considerable tax earnings which can be redirected towards community services such as education, healthcare, and infrastructure. Nevertheless, the economic effects just isn't completely constructive. Difficulty gambling can lead to financial damage for individuals, increasing the burden on social companies and healthcare units. The loss of productiveness, household breakdowns, and also felony activities relevant to gambling debt can offset the monetary Added benefits that betting provides to economies.

The web has revolutionized betting, making it far more available than in the past before. Nowadays, any one that has a smartphone can spot a bet in seconds, no matter whether with a Dwell sports occasion, a virtual slot machine, or even a sport of poker in opposition to opponents from throughout the world. This ease has broadened the betting viewers appreciably. Not confined to casinos or racetracks, on the net betting caters to men and women of any age and demographics. It also enables capabilities like Dwell betting, where wagers are placed although an party is in progress, and micro-betting, which consists of wagering on little, in-match results. Algorithm-pushed predictions even more increase the experience for modern consumers. Nevertheless, electronic betting also raises issues about dependancy, fraud, underage gambling, and deficiency of regulation in a few regions. It poses exclusive challenges to policymakers and mental wellness gurus who will have to now think about the psychological consequences of 24/7 entry to gambling platforms.

Even with its leisure benefit, betting includes considerable risks. Challenge gambling is a serious affliction that has an effect on millions worldwide. Symptoms consist of compulsive betting, lying to hide gambling habits, chasing losses, and neglecting responsibilities or relationships. Financial damage is an additional critical consequence. Numerous persons spiral into financial debt, provide property, or just take out loans in an try to get back again losses—only to finish up deeper in fiscal distress. Social effects involve family members breakdowns, task loss, psychological wellness Problems, As well as in Extraordinary instances, suicide. Although most of the people who guess do so responsibly, the minority who fall into dependancy can practical experience daily life-altering consequences.

To mitigate the risks connected to betting, quite a few governments and companies market dependable gambling methods. These include self-exclusion courses, which permit people today to ban themselves from casinos or betting Sites. Deposit and deadlines assistance customers cap the amount time or dollars they invest betting. Recognition campaigns educate the public on the pitfalls of issue gambling and the way to find support. Assistance services, including counseling, hotlines, and assist groups, are created accessible for People affected. Liable operators are inspired to employ ethical procedures, including transparent odds, age verification, and delivering suitable client help for at-chance end users.
